Barbecued Fish

Ingredients
  • 4 skinless pomfret
  • 6 dried Kashmiri chillies
  • 2 chopped onions
  • 2 teaspoon of tamarind pulp
  • 1 teaspoon of cumin seeds
  • 1/2 teaspoon of turmeric
  • 1 teaspoon of black peppercorns
  • 2 cloves of chopped garlic
  • teaspoon of sugar
  • 1 tablespoon of cider vinegar
  • Rice flour for dusting
Method of Preparation
  • Before starting the actual recipe, you need to soak the chillies in warm water for around 10 minutes. Drain the water and remove the seeds from chillies.
  • Put the chillies, tamarind, cumin seeds, turmeric, peppercorns, garlic, onion, sugar and vinegar in a fine mixer (food processor) and blend until smooth. Add salt to taste.
  • Spread this spice paste on both the sides of the pomfret fillet, dust with rice flour.
  • These pomfret fillets can be cooked on a barbecue or a preheated grill for 1-2 minutes on both sides.
Baked Potatoes

Ingredients
  • Potatoes
  • Filling as required
Method of Preparation
  • If you wish to cook the potatoes directly on the barbecue or the bonfire, you need to wash and wrap them in foils individually. Cook them in the barbecue for 1-1 hours.
  • Other ways, in order to save them, you can precook them in an oven or a microwave till properly baked. These semi cooked potatoes can be grilled on the barbecue until crisp!
  • Scoop out the potato and fill filling of your choice in the potato. Cheese and bacon, baked beans and grated cheese, cream cheese, scrambled egg, etc. make up excellent filling.
